Objective To investigate the chemical constituents from Ficus pumila and to provide the material basis for quality control.Methods The chemical constituents were separated and purified by silica gel,Sephadex LH-20,ODS,and preparative HPLC column chromatographies.Their structures were determined by physicochemical properties and spectral data analyses.Results From 95% ethanol extract of F.pumila,21 compounds were isolated and identified as rutin(1),kaempferol 3-O-α-L-rhamnopyranosyl(1→6)-β-D-glucopyranoside(2),isoquercitrin(3),quercitrin(4),dihydrokaempferol 5-O-β-D-glucopyranoside(5),dihydro-kaempferol 7-O-β-D-glucopyranoside(6),maesopsin 6-O-β-D-glucopyranoside(7),secoisolariciresinol 9-O-β-D-glucopyranoside(8),chlorogenic acid(9),protocatechuic acid(10),caffeic acid(11),5-O-caffeoyl quinic acid methyl ester(12),p-hytroxybenzoic acid(13),vanillic acid(14),5-O-caffeoyl quinic acid butyl ester(15),β-amyrin acetate(16),daucosterol(17),phaseic acid(18),vomifoliol(19),(1′S,6′R)-8′-hydroxyabscisic acid β-D-glucoside(20),and 1-methyl-1,2,3,4-tetrahydro-β-carboline-3-carboxylic acid(21).Conclusion Compounds 5—15,18,20,and 21 are isolated from this plant for the first time,and compound 5—8,12,15,20,and 21 are found in plants of Ficus Linn.for the first time.
